Job description

We are seeking a Senior KYC Analyst to join our Client Lifecycle Management (CLM) team in London, supporting large-scale KYC projects. The role involves processing KYC files, conducting end-to-end Customer Due Diligence (CDD) reviews across various jurisdictions and entity types, and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ements and client procedures. This is an excellent opportunity to grow within a dynamic business environment, working with leading financial institutions.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Perform remediation, onboarding, and periodic KYC reviews.
  2. Understand and apply AML policies, identifying requirements and updating client information.
  3. Gather and analyze KYC documentation to identify gaps.
  4. Source data from approved public sources following policies.
  5. Construct comprehensive KYC files.
  6. Serve as a go-to expert for complex files and structures.
  7. Keep stakeholders informed of progress and issues.
  8. Escalate issues to appropriate teams.
  9. Coordinate with internal departments to obtain necessary information.
  10. Conduct screening checks for sanctions, PEPs, and adverse media.
  11. Identify and address blockers to KYC completion.

Requirements:

  1. Extensive AML/KYC due diligence experience.
  2. Knowledge of global AML/KYC regulations and guidelines.
  3. Experience with end-to-end client onboarding processes.
  4. Proficiency in performing due diligence on various corporate entities worldwide.
  5. Experience with PEPs, sanctions, and negative media screening.
  6. Knowledge of AML typologies and red flags.
  7. Ability to handle complex information with high attention to detail.
  8. Proactive, fast learner with a sense of urgency.
  9. Strong multitasking, prioritization, and accountability skills.
  10. Flexible and adaptable approach.
  11.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written.
  12. Ability to learn multiple IT systems.
  13. Experience in consulting, service provision, investment, or corporate banking environments.
